Our Sacred Heritage

The Sri Sri Krishna Balaram Mandir stands as a testament to the vision of His Divine Grace A.C. Bhaktivedanta Swami Prabhupada, the Founder-Acharya of ISKCON.

Located in the holy Raman Reti area of Vrindavan, this magnificent temple was established in 1975 as a place where devotees from around the world could come together to worship the transcendental brothers Krishna and Balaram in the very land where They performed Their divine pastimes over 5,000 years ago.

The temple represents the fulfilled dream of Srila Prabhupada, who personally oversaw every aspect of its design and construction, creating a sanctuary of unparalleled spiritual beauty and significance.

Our Journey Through Time

1966

His Divine Grace A.C. Bhaktivedanta Swami Prabhupada establishes ISKCON in New York City, beginning the global spread of Krishna consciousness.

1971

Srila Prabhupada first visits Vrindavan and envisions building a magnificent temple for Krishna and Balaram in this sacred land.

1975

The Sri Sri Krishna Balaram Mandir is inaugurated, marking the fulfillment of Srila Prabhupada's cherished dream.

1977

Srila Prabhupada enters eternal samadhi in Vrindavan, leaving behind a spiritual legacy that continues to inspire millions.

Present

The temple continues to serve as a major pilgrimage destination, welcoming hundreds of thousands of visitors annually from around the world.

Spiritual Significance

Sacred Location

Built in Raman Reti, the very place where Krishna and Balaram played as children, making it one of the most sacred sites in Vrindavan.

Global Unity

Represents the international character of ISKCON, bringing together devotees from all countries and cultures in the spirit of universal brotherhood.

Vedic Wisdom

Serves as a center for the study and practice of authentic Vedic knowledge as presented in the Bhagavad-gita and Srimad-Bhagavatam.
